diff --git a/assets/css/build/frontend.css b/assets/css/build/frontend.css index 99c08dc..c1486b3 100644 --- a/assets/css/build/frontend.css +++ b/assets/css/build/frontend.css @@ -1,4 +1,4 @@ -/*! wp-login-flow - v3.0.2 - 2019-05-30 */#wplf-loader { +/*! wp-login-flow - v3.0.3 - 2019-07-19 */#wplf-loader { display: none; z-index: 99999; position: fixed; diff --git a/assets/css/build/vendor.css b/assets/css/build/vendor.css index 80c2091..c17f36d 100644 --- a/assets/css/build/vendor.css +++ b/assets/css/build/vendor.css @@ -1 +1 @@ -/*! wp-login-flow - v3.0.2 - 2019-05-30 */ \ No newline at end of file +/*! wp-login-flow - v3.0.3 - 2019-07-19 */ \ No newline at end of file diff --git a/assets/css/build/wplf.css b/assets/css/build/wplf.css index c0b511d..1abfe8c 100644 --- a/assets/css/build/wplf.css +++ b/assets/css/build/wplf.css @@ -1,4 +1,4 @@ -/*! wp-login-flow - v3.0.2 - 2019-05-30 */#wplf-all-settings { +/*! wp-login-flow - v3.0.3 - 2019-07-19 */#wplf-all-settings { margin-top: -1px; } #wplf-all-settings .wp-editor-wrap iframe { diff --git a/assets/css/frontend.min.css b/assets/css/frontend.min.css index 025112f..670ae3a 100644 --- a/assets/css/frontend.min.css +++ b/assets/css/frontend.min.css @@ -1 +1 @@ -/*! wp-login-flow - v3.0.2 - 2019-05-30 */#wplf-loader{display:none;z-index:99999;position:fixed;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);-o-transform:translate(-50%,-50%);transform:translate(-50%,-50%);-webkit-transform:-webkit-translate(-50%,-50%);transform:-webkit-translate(-50%,-50%);transform:-moz-translate(-50%,-50%);-ms-transform:-ms-translate(-50%,-50%);transform:-ms-translate(-50%,-50%);font-size:2em}#wplf-loader-icon{font-size:2em;width:auto;height:auto;-webkit-animation:wplfspinner 1s infinite ease-in-out reverse;-o-animation:wplfspinner 1s infinite ease-in-out reverse;animation:wplfspinner 1s infinite ease-in-out reverse}@-webkit-keyframes wplfspinner{from{-webkit-transform:rotate(0)}to{-webkit-transform:rotate(360deg)}}@-o-keyframes wplfspinner{from{-o-transform:rotate(0);transform:rotate(0)}to{-o-transform:rotate(360deg);transform:rotate(360deg)}}@keyframes wplfspinner{from{-webkit-transform:rotate(0);-o-transform:rotate(0);transform:rotate(0)}to{-webkit-transform:rotate(360deg);-o-transform:rotate(360deg);transform:rotate(360deg)}} \ No newline at end of file +/*! wp-login-flow - v3.0.3 - 2019-07-19 */#wplf-loader{display:none;z-index:99999;position:fixed;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);-o-transform:translate(-50%,-50%);transform:translate(-50%,-50%);-webkit-transform:-webkit-translate(-50%,-50%);transform:-webkit-translate(-50%,-50%);transform:-moz-translate(-50%,-50%);-ms-transform:-ms-translate(-50%,-50%);transform:-ms-translate(-50%,-50%);font-size:2em}#wplf-loader-icon{font-size:2em;width:auto;height:auto;-webkit-animation:wplfspinner 1s infinite ease-in-out reverse;-o-animation:wplfspinner 1s infinite ease-in-out reverse;animation:wplfspinner 1s infinite ease-in-out reverse}@-webkit-keyframes wplfspinner{from{-webkit-transform:rotate(0)}to{-webkit-transform:rotate(360deg)}}@-o-keyframes wplfspinner{from{-o-transform:rotate(0);transform:rotate(0)}to{-o-transform:rotate(360deg);transform:rotate(360deg)}}@keyframes wplfspinner{from{-webkit-transform:rotate(0);-o-transform:rotate(0);transform:rotate(0)}to{-webkit-transform:rotate(360deg);-o-transform:rotate(360deg);transform:rotate(360deg)}} \ No newline at end of file diff --git a/assets/css/vendor.min.css b/assets/css/vendor.min.css index 80c2091..c17f36d 100644 --- a/assets/css/vendor.min.css +++ b/assets/css/vendor.min.css @@ -1 +1 @@ -/*! wp-login-flow - v3.0.2 - 2019-05-30 */ \ No newline at end of file +/*! wp-login-flow - v3.0.3 - 2019-07-19 */ \ No newline at end of file diff --git a/assets/css/wplf.min.css b/assets/css/wplf.min.css index dcd7431..f06face 100644 --- a/assets/css/wplf.min.css +++ b/assets/css/wplf.min.css @@ -1 +1 @@ -/*! wp-login-flow - v3.0.2 - 2019-05-30 */#wplf-all-settings{margin-top:-1px}#wplf-all-settings .wp-editor-wrap iframe{min-height:150px}#wplf-all-settings h2{font-size:18px;font-variant:small-caps;padding:6px;text-align:center;text-transform:full-width;margin-top:0;margin-bottom:0}#wplf-all-settings .form-table{margin-top:0;background:#f1f1f1}#wplf-all-settings .form-table th{padding-left:20px}#wplf-all-settings .settings_panel{border-top:none}#wplf-all-settings .settings_panel #wplf-settings-inside{-webkit-box-shadow:0 0 5px 1px #ccc;box-shadow:0 0 5px 1px #ccc}#wplf-all-settings h3.permalink-error{text-align:center;background-color:#a23333;margin-top:0;margin-bottom:0;color:#ffed00;padding:8px}#wplf-all-settings .wplf-rewrite-conflict{margin-top:10px;border:1px solid #b00;background-color:#ffadad;padding:5px;border-radius:5px}#wplf-all-settings .wplf-textbox{min-width:15em}#wplf-all-settings pre{display:inline-block;margin:0}#wplf-nav-tabs .nav-tab-active,#wplf-nav-tabs .nav-tab-active:hover{border-bottom:none;color:#fff}#wplf-nav-tabs .nav-tab:hover{color:#222}.wplf-repeatable-wrap .repeatable-fields-handle{font-size:18px;width:35px;float:left}.wplf-repeatable-wrap .wplf-repeatable-form{margin-right:-10px}.wplf-repeatable-wrap .wplf-repeatable-form table:nth-of-type(even) tbody{background-color:#efefef}.wplf-repeatable-wrap .wplf-repeatable-form table{margin:0}.wplf-repeatable-wrap .wplf-repeatable-form .repeatable-field{float:left}.wplf-repeatable-wrap .wplf-repeatable-form .repeatable-field th{width:auto}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up{margin-left:-10px;border-bottom:1px solid #dedede}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up:first-child .remove-group-row{display:none}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up thead{float:left;width:30px;cursor:-webkit-grab;cursor:-moz-grab;cursor:grab;height:40px;text-align:center;background:#dedede}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up thead :active{cursor:-webkit-grabbing;cursor:-moz-grabbing;cursor:grabbing}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up tbody{border-left:3px solid #dedede;float:right;width:-webkit-calc(100% - 33px);width:calc(100% - 33px)}@media (min-width:600px){.wplf-repeatable-wrap .repeatable-option{width:48%}}.wplf-repeatable-wrap .repeatable-option:nth-of-type(n+3):nth-of-type(-n+5){width:25%;margin-left:5%}.wplf-repeatable-wrap .repeatable-option:nth-of-type(even) th{padding-left:10px}.wplf-repeatable-wrap .repeatable-fields-remove-td{float:right;margin-bottom:0}.wplf-repeatable-wrap .repeatable-add-group-row{padding-top:10px} \ No newline at end of file +/*! wp-login-flow - v3.0.3 - 2019-07-19 */#wplf-all-settings{margin-top:-1px}#wplf-all-settings .wp-editor-wrap iframe{min-height:150px}#wplf-all-settings h2{font-size:18px;font-variant:small-caps;padding:6px;text-align:center;text-transform:full-width;margin-top:0;margin-bottom:0}#wplf-all-settings .form-table{margin-top:0;background:#f1f1f1}#wplf-all-settings .form-table th{padding-left:20px}#wplf-all-settings .settings_panel{border-top:none}#wplf-all-settings .settings_panel #wplf-settings-inside{-webkit-box-shadow:0 0 5px 1px #ccc;box-shadow:0 0 5px 1px #ccc}#wplf-all-settings h3.permalink-error{text-align:center;background-color:#a23333;margin-top:0;margin-bottom:0;color:#ffed00;padding:8px}#wplf-all-settings .wplf-rewrite-conflict{margin-top:10px;border:1px solid #b00;background-color:#ffadad;padding:5px;border-radius:5px}#wplf-all-settings .wplf-textbox{min-width:15em}#wplf-all-settings pre{display:inline-block;margin:0}#wplf-nav-tabs .nav-tab-active,#wplf-nav-tabs .nav-tab-active:hover{border-bottom:none;color:#fff}#wplf-nav-tabs .nav-tab:hover{color:#222}.wplf-repeatable-wrap .repeatable-fields-handle{font-size:18px;width:35px;float:left}.wplf-repeatable-wrap .wplf-repeatable-form{margin-right:-10px}.wplf-repeatable-wrap .wplf-repeatable-form table:nth-of-type(even) tbody{background-color:#efefef}.wplf-repeatable-wrap .wplf-repeatable-form table{margin:0}.wplf-repeatable-wrap .wplf-repeatable-form .repeatable-field{float:left}.wplf-repeatable-wrap .wplf-repeatable-form .repeatable-field th{width:auto}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up{margin-left:-10px;border-bottom:1px solid #dedede}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up:first-child .remove-group-row{display:none}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up thead{float:left;width:30px;cursor:-webkit-grab;cursor:-moz-grab;cursor:grab;height:40px;text-align:center;background:#dedede}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up thead :active{cursor:-webkit-grabbing;cursor:-moz-grabbing;cursor:grabbing}.wplf-repeatable-wrap .wplf-repeatable-form .rowGroup tbody{border-left:3px solid #dedede;float:right;width:-webkit-calc(100% - 33px);width:calc(100% - 33px)}@media (min-width:600px){.wplf-repeatable-wrap .repeatable-option{width:48%}}.wplf-repeatable-wrap .repeatable-option:nth-of-type(n+3):nth-of-type(-n+5){width:25%;margin-left:5%}.wplf-repeatable-wrap .repeatable-option:nth-of-type(even) th{padding-left:10px}.wplf-repeatable-wrap .repeatable-fields-remove-td{float:right;margin-bottom:0}.wplf-repeatable-wrap .repeatable-add-group-row{padding-top:10px} \ No newline at end of file diff --git a/languages/wp-login-flow.pot b/languages/wp-login-flow.pot index a874413..7fd6f99 100644 --- a/languages/wp-login-flow.pot +++ b/languages/wp-login-flow.pot @@ -2,9 +2,9 @@ # This file is distributed under the same license as the WP Login Flow package. msgid "" msgstr "" -"Project-Id-Version: WP Login Flow 3.0.2\n" +"Project-Id-Version: WP Login Flow 3.0.3\n" "Report-Msgid-Bugs-To: http://plugins.smyl.es\n" -"POT-Creation-Date: 2019-05-30 20:41:39+00:00\n" +"POT-Creation-Date: 2019-07-19 16:50:55+00:00\n" "MIME-Version: 1.0\n" "Content-Type: text/plain; charset=utf-8\n" "Content-Transfer-Encoding: 8bit\n" @@ -35,18 +35,18 @@ msgstr "" msgid "Possible reason: your host may have disabled the mail() function." msgstr "" -#: classes/login.php:136 +#: classes/login.php:139 msgid "Set Password" msgstr "" -#: classes/login.php:179 +#: classes/login.php:182 msgid "" "

Thank you for registering. Please check your email for your activation " "link.

If you do not receive the email please request a password reset to have the email sent again.

" msgstr "" -#: classes/login.php:182 +#: classes/login.php:185 msgid "Pending Activation" msgstr "" diff --git a/package.json b/package.json index fe56e50..157aed7 100644 --- a/package.json +++ b/package.json @@ -2,7 +2,7 @@ "name": "wp-login-flow", "title": "WP Login Flow", "acronym": "wplf", - "version": "3.0.2", + "version": "3.0.3", "homepage": "http://plugins.smyl.es", "author_homepage": "http://smyl.es", "class": "WP_Login_Flow", diff --git a/readme.md b/readme.md index 4fba096..198968f 100644 --- a/readme.md +++ b/readme.md @@ -3,8 +3,8 @@ **Donate link:** https://www.patreon.com/smyles **Tags:** wp-login, wp-login.php, login flow, wp login flow, activation, activate, email, background, responsive, color, login, customize, custom, permalink, rewrite, url, register, lost, forgot, password, template, reset, register, registration, password, password registration, admin bar, smyles, tripflex **Requires at least:** 4.4 -**Tested up to:** 5.2.1 -**Stable tag:** 3.0.2 +**Tested up to:** 5.2.2 +**Stable tag:** 3.0.3 **License:** GPLv3 wp-login permalinks, auto login, register w/ pass, login/logout redirects, email as username, bg/logo/color customizations, hide admin bar, and more! @@ -154,6 +154,10 @@ Yes! It works with any version of WordPress 4.4 or newer! ## Changelog ## +### 3.0.3 - July 19, 2019 ### +* Fix login/register loader not being added when activation is not enabled +* Bump tested up to 5.2.2 + ### 3.0.2 - May 30, 2019 ### * Use `login_headertext` for 5.2.0+ instead of `login_headertitle` * Bump tested up to 5.2.1 diff --git a/wp-login-flow.php b/wp-login-flow.php index 0a7cdc8..c741f3f 100644 --- a/wp-login-flow.php +++ b/wp-login-flow.php @@ -5,7 +5,7 @@ * Description: Complete wp-login.php customization, including rewrites, require email activation, email templates, custom colors, logo, link, responsiveness, border radius, and more! * Author: Myles McNamara * Author URI: http://smyl.es - * Version: 3.0.2 + * Version: 3.0.3 * Last Updated: @@timestamp * Domain Path: /languages * Text Domain: wp_login_flow @@ -28,7 +28,7 @@ const PLUGIN_SLUG = 'wp-login-flow'; const PROD_ID = 'WP Login Flow'; - const VERSION = '3.0.2'; + const VERSION = '3.0.3'; /** * @var Singleton Instance */